The same updates also need to be made for the case where the host device does not support the block limits VPD page at all and we emulate the whole page. Without this fix, on host block devices a maximum transfer length of (INT_MAX - sector_size) bytes is advertised to the guest, resulting in I/O errors when a request that exceeds the host limits is made by the guest. (Prior to commit 24b36e9813e, this code path would use the max_transfer value from the host instead of INT_MAX, but still miss the fix from 01ef8185b80 where max_transfer is also capped to max_iov host pages, so it would be less wrong, but still wrong.)
